Abstract
Systems and methods provide flow rate measuring and control of drives, like fluid circulators, using non-disruptive sensors giving fluid pressures, temperature, density, pressure drop, etc. at or across the drive. Using these sensor outputs, drive operation, and a relationship of coefficients based on the same, the mass flow rate can be calculated. The sensors may be fully outside the conduit or at its inner surface on either side of the circulator with no other change. Fluid flow does not have to be redirected or interacted with, enhancing fluid flow efficiency and system life. Example systems can be installed on existing or new drives requiring only small conduit changes to verify or establish mass flow rates for drive operation.
